ATI Stellram’s XE solid carbide end mill is designed to slot and profile to higher radial and axial engagements, and run at higher surface speeds and feeds in difficult-to-machine materials. The tool is designed to run fast and cool. Also, through-tool coolant and a deep-flute design evacuate chips more efficiently. The tool’s longer shaft maximizes clamping and reach, and it helps minimize vibration. The end mill is manufactured from a submicron substrate and is coated with PVD Nano TiAlN.
